Hi Jake,
Please verify the following --
1) If you reboot your machine and the problem still exists?
2) If yes, then you might try verifying in case you have dual monitor and the application might be opened on second montior (which could be disconnected may be)
3) Is the problem persists, try recreating your preferences --
on Xp: C:Documents and Settings\Local SettingsApplication DataAdobeCaptivate 5
- on Vista/Win7:C:Users\AppDataLocalAdobeCaptivate 5
and then relaunch. Let me know if it still doesn't work.

    '''Try Firefox Safe Mode''' to see if the problem goes away. [[Troubleshoot Firefox issues using Safe Mode|Firefox Safe Mode]] is a troubleshooting mode that temporarily turns off hardware acceleration, resets some settings, and disables add-ons (extensions and themes).
    '''If Firefox is open,''' you can restart in Firefox Safe Mode from the Help menu:
    * Click the menu button [[Image:New Fx Menu]], click Help [[Image:Help-29]] and select ''Restart with Add-ons Disabled''.
    '''If Firefox is not running,''' you can start Firefox in Safe Mode as follows:
    * On Windows: Hold the '''Shift''' key when you open the Firefox desktop or Start menu shortcut.
    * On Mac: Hold the '''option''' key while starting Firefox.
    * On Linux: Quit Firefox, go to your Terminal and run ''firefox -safe-mode'' <br>(you may need to specify the Firefox installation path e.g. /usr/lib/firefox)
    When the Firefox Safe Mode window appears, select "Start in Safe Mode".
    ;[[Image:SafeMode-Fx35]]
    '''''If the issue is not present in Firefox Safe Mode''''', your problem is probably caused by an extension, theme, or hardware acceleration. Please follow the steps in the [[Troubleshoot extensions, themes and hardware acceleration issues to solve common Firefox problems]] article to find the cause.
    ''To exit Firefox Safe Mode, just close Firefox and wait a few seconds before opening Firefox for normal use again.''

  • Lightroom 5 will not start but shows as running in task manager?

    Hi,
    I'm using Lightroom 5.7 (64 bit) on a Win7 machine and it was working perfectly until a few days ago. Now for reasons unknown to me, it will now not start correctly. According to Task Manager it is running but nothing appears on screen. It shows as a running process using about 15,020k. If I try and end the process it will not stop until I have tried 4 or 5 times.
    I have tried renaming the preview file to force it to build a new file, and optimizing the data base and it ran once, said it was checking the catalog, and then reverted to the same behaviour.
    If I can get it started I can revert to a backup database.
    Help appreciated.
    Peter

    Thanks for the input.
    Turns out Lightroom not guilty.  The hard drive containing the catalogue was failing and although tests seemed to show it as OK it was actually only reading / writing at a fraction of the correct speed. So Lightroom was taking a long time to read it's own catalogue.  It tooks 48 hours to copy 1 gig of data off the disk.
